Urban Studies is the 210th most popular major in the country with 1,475 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, urban studies gra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$37,971 and had an average of $24,376 in loans still to pay off.

Top 1 Best Value Doctor’s Degree Colleges for Urban Studies in Oregon
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Portland State University.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Urban Studies Schools for a Doctorate in Oregon. Located in Portland, Oregon, this large public school handed out 6 diplomas to qualified doctorate’s urban studies students in 2019-2020.
Portland State University not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#1 on our “Best Urban Studies Doctor’s Degree Schools in Oregon” list. Although you might pay more or less depending on your area of study, average graduate tuition and fees at Portland State University are $23,784.
